Canadian Digital Asset Ownership Plummets Amid Global Regulatory Uncertainty: Bank Of Canada
Cryptocurrency ownership in Canada declined in 2022 due to a plethora of factors including uncertainty in regulation, fear of digital asset scams, and unfavorable market conditions. A new survey, the Bitcoin Omnibus Surv...
